Excise stamps marked "2009" to be put in use in Armenia
from December 10

  • 11-12-2008 16:16:00   | Armenia  |  Economy
YEREVAN, DECEMBER 11, NOYAN TAPAN. At the December 11 sitting, the Armenian government made a decision to put in use excise stamps marked "2009" for marking alcoholic drinks and cigarettes made in Armenia - starting from December 10, 2008. It was also decided to withdraw from use the excise stamps marked "2004" and "2005" for marking some goods made in Armenia and liable to excise tax - starting from January 1, 2009. By the decision, starting from October 1, 2009, the sale of cigarettes made in Armenia and marked with excise stamps with marking "2004" as well as alcoholic drinks made in Armenia and marked with excise stamps with marking "2005" will be prohibited in Armenia. According to the RA Government Information and PR Department, the chairman of the RA State Revenue Committee was instructed to approve the order of withdrawal and destruction of unused and/or damaged excise stamps marked "2004" and "2005" for marking goods made in Armenia and to ensure the implementation of this work by April 1, 2009.
